#017333 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#017333 is composed of 0.4% red, 45.1%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.7%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 146.3 degrees, a saturation of 98.3% and a lightness of 22.7%. #017333 color hex could be obtained by blending #02e666 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

● #017333 color description : Dark c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#017333 has RGB values of R:1, G:115,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0, Y:0.56,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 95027.
